Malai kofta in red gravy instructions
- To prepare gravy, first heat oil and butter in a nonstick pan. Fry ginger-garlic-green chilli paste and then onion till it turns slightly brown..
- Add grated tomatoes, salt, chilli powder, jeera powder, kitchen king masala, and dhaniya jeera powder. Toss kasoori methi a bit till crunchy and then rub it in between your palms over the curry. Mix everything and fry well for about 3-4 min or till oil oozes. Make a smooth paste of cashew, magattari and poppy seeds using a bit of water to grind. Add it in the gravy. Combine everything..
- Lightly run the paubhaji crusher through this mixure and mash it up to get smooth texture as much as possible. Add about 1/4 cup water, mix and then add milk powder. Combine well and fry for a minute or two or till oil oozes. Add a cup or two water to adjust the consistency of the gravy. Add fresh cream and cheese. Blend everything well and fry till oil oozes on the surface. Gravy is ready..
- For kofta: Boil potatoes in salty water. Peel and mash them smooth. Add salt and cornflour. Combine everything well and ensure that there are no pieces of potatoes left in it. Combine all the items for kofta stuffing..
- Take a lemon size ball of potato, make it smooth in your palm. Press it between the palms to make thepli. Fold your palm a bit to make the pli deep in between. Fill in the stuffing and seal it gently. You can fold your palm further more to bring the edges together to make it easy to seal..
- Press and turn this ball gently like you are making laddus. This will seal the kofta well all around and shape it. Make smooth balls. Sprinkle a little corn over them. Shake a ball at a time on your fingers to spread the flour evenly and to get rid of excess flour..
- Heat oil near to smoking temperature. Put a ball on the frying spoon and gently slide it in the oil. Place a few ball like this in the oil and fry light brown. Remove from oil..
- For Serving : just at the time of serving, place the koftas in the serving plate. Pour gravy over them and garnish with fresh cream..
The red color in the gravy comes from the addition of tomatoes and red chilli powder. Malai Kofta dish goes very with all Indian breads like naan, roti, missi moti as. Malai Kofta is a rich savoury curry/gravy from the Moghlai origin. Koftas made and added to a rich tomato cream base sauce which serves as a great side dish for rotis or even pulaos.
